Level 2 charging requires a 240V connection and significantly reduces charging time, commonly found at public stations or installed at home by EV owners. DC fast charging is the quickest method, typically used for commercial or highway-side stations. It can recharge a battery up to 80% in 30. .

On June 21, local time, during the 2025 African Energy Forum, China Nengjian signed an EPC contract with Globeleq, a British independent power producer, for the largest single battery energy storage power station in Africa, the 153MW/612 MWh battery energy storage project in Hongsha, South Africa. .
